This is the likely reason. This can also happen if you reply to another member and quote their post in your reply--and their post contains a hyperlink.
Also, FlyerTalk has been hit by an increased wave of spam over the last few weeks, and so the admins have "dialed up" the aggressiveness of the filter that decides whether a moderator needs to approve your post, so even some posts that don't include hyperlinks are being filtered for approval by a moderator.
Don't worry; it'll go away pretty quickly for you.
The "alert a moderator" triangle is there for everyone to help the moderators. If you see a post that needs our attention--is off topic, rude, spam, etc.--just hit it and type a brief explanation and the mods will get an alert to take a peek at it. Sometimes, we can't read every post, so we rely on users like you to help us spot stuff that needs our attention. More on that
